On February 11, 2025, the Capital Program Committee of Nantucket convened for a meeting that began promptly at 10:09 AM. The session commenced with a roll call, confirming the presence of committee members including Jill Veith, Howard Matz, Caroline Balzer, John Kitchener, Don Holgate, and Christy Kickham, along with staff member Carmel.
